The new Sandvik screen

The Sandvik QA331 is a state-of-the-art three-way-split screener based on the world leading Sandvik QA330. The brand new model (Fig.) now comes with improved screening capacity, and is an equally robust, highly durable machine, which has been designed specifically for the recycling and contractor market. Its increased productivity and accurate screening will ensure that it meets customer needs wherever it is used. The screen is suitable for the production of aggregate, top soil and remediation as well as for the recycling of building materials. At the heart of the QA331 is a 4.27 m x 1.52 m two-bearing screen box that possesses an increased six-degree screening angle in-built into the bottom deck of the screen. This feature, coupled with the larger screening surface area, and increased throw on the screen box, enhances screening efficiency and capacity through the actual screen box itself.

 

The key features and values of the Sandvik  QA331 may be summarized as follows:

• High production rate through large screening area, high frequency adjustable angle, double-deck screen and a six-degree-inclined angle on the screen box to produce a “banana” effect

• Fully capable of working at the quarry face, inner city development or recycling centre

• Modern chassis I beam design ensures maximum durability for arduous conditions.

• Global aftermarket support, with standard stock parts to ensure maximum uptime.

• Machine designed for optimum fuel economy and low operating costs

 

The Sandvik QA331 has a unique folding access walkway fitted as standard around the screen box, thus providing the operator with easy access for maintenance. Additionally, the hopper has a 7 m³ capacity and comes complete with a radio controlled tipping reject grid as standard. The main conveyor is fitted with a 1050 mm heavy-duty belt for processing efficiency, possesses tracks measuring 500 mm in width to cater for various ground conditions, and is pendant-track-controlled for ease of mobility.
